The Wiley CPAexcel Study Guide: Business Environment and Concepts arms CPA test?takers with detailed text and skill?building problems to help identify, focus on, and master the specific topics that may need additional reinforcement to pass the BEC section of the CPA Exam.
This essential study guide:
- Covers the complete AICPA content blueprint in BEC
- Explains every topic tested with 662 pages of study text, 599 multiple?choice questions, and 6 task?based simulations in BEC
- Organized in Bite?Sized Lesson format with 149 lessons in BEC
- Maps perfectly to the Wiley CPAexcel online course; may be used to complement the course or as a stand?alone study tool
